As a Lead Software Engineer at JPMorgan Chase in the Athena Core DevTools team, you will design and build systems that accelerate and improve the daily work of thousands of engineers. You will shape the engineering experience from code creation to production release, partnering with teams across technology, platform engineering, and governance. Job Responsibilities:
- Build and evolve developer-facing products, including IDE experiences, web tooling, test infrastructure, and SDLC workflows
- Improve productivity and confidence for thousands of engineers through impactful tooling
- Own features throughout their lifecycle: discovery, design, implementation, rollout, telemetry, and operational support
- Translate ambiguous challenges into scalable platform capabilities
- Drives team adoption of enterprise-authorized AI-assisted engineering practices within the work environment to improve code quality, delivery speed, and operational outcomes (e.g., AI-assisted code review/refactoring, test strategy acceleration, incident/root-cause analysis support), while establishing consistent validation standards (secure coding, peer review, automated testing) and promoting reuse of effective patterns across the team.
- Applies knowledge of tools within the Software Development Life Cycle toolchain, including enterprise-authorized AI-assisted development and automation capabilities, to improve the value realized by automation.
- Partner with controls and audit stakeholders to implement effective, low-friction engineering controls
- Influence engineering standards and best practices across a broad developer community
- Design and implement IDE and editor capabilities for smarter navigation and code intelligence
- Drive AI adoption in local development tools to enhance software development practices
- Develop static analysis and auto-remediation tools to prevent errors before production
- Build test frameworks and scheduling systems for large-scale workloads, including cloud-based execution
- Create platform tooling to identify code duplication, dead code, and opportunities for codebase simplification

What We Do
JPMorgan Chase & Co. (NYSE: JPM) is a leading global financial services firm with assets of $3.7 trillion and operations worldwide. The firm is a leader in investment banking, financial services for consumers and small businesses, commercial banking, financial transaction processing, and asset management. A component of the Dow Jones Industrial Average, JPMorgan Chase & Co. serves millions of consumers in the United States and many of the world’s most prominent corporate, institutional and government clients under its J.P. Morgan and Chase brands. Technology fuels every aspect of our company and is at the heart of everything we do. With over 50,000 technologists globally and an annual tech spend of $12 billion, we are dedicated to improving the design, analytics, development, coding, testing and application programming that goes into creating high quality software and new products.
